Parents ‘disgusted’ as GAA club asks teenage girls to stop wearing short shorts due to male coaches feeling ‘uncomfortable’WhatsApp message sent on Wexford underage girls team’s group chat has been met with considerable anger among some parentsGettyJessica O'Connor New Ross Standard Today at 17:04Young teenage girls who play Ladies Gaelic football for a Co Wexford club team have been asked to be “wary of the size of their shorts” due to it apparently making some male coaches “uncomfortable”. The request has sparked concern among some parents, who feel the children are being “sexualised”.
